Job description

Keep an assigned area of the Day Lodge clean, orderly and well presented for Deer Valley Resort guests. Maintain restaurant floor service standards. Tasks involved include clearing trays, wiping and rearranging tables and chairs, attending the Beverage Bar, emptying bus carts, drying and filling tray and silverware stands. Greet, assist, direct and anticipate guest needs is required to present the high service level of Deer Valley Resort restaurants. Report to work in ample time in proper uniform and neatly groomed for the start of your shift. Have a thorough knowledge of all Deer Valley services. If you are unsure, find a supervisor or manager for assistance. Assist our guests with any service needs. Refer any sensitive situations to the manager on duty. Assist each other when necessary. Efficient operations require teamwork and cooperation with your fellow employees. You may be asked to help in other departments as well as your own. Maintain proper order in designated storage areas. Carefully handle furniture and fixtures when moving them. Adhere to the Floor Service Standards at all times.

Special Requirements

Must have or be able to get Utah Food Handlers Permit
The ability to lift 35 pounds.
On-the-job training is provided.
Following Shifts available 7 days a week including weekends and holidays. 7:15am - 4:30pm, 8:00am - 4:30pm, including weekends and holidays.
Wage Per Hour: $11.20 - $25.32. Overtime possible at hourly wage of $16.80 - $37.98
Possible Wage Increase: Deer Valley offers pay raises based on performance and merit. Each employee receives a performance review at the end of each season, based on these reviews employees will receive a merit from 0% - 5% for the start of the next winter season. Employee's may receive spot raises based on their performance.
